I would be pretty wary of cheap e-bay turbos. You want to make sure it's a GENUINE brand name, they can spin over 100,000 RPM - lots of tight tolerances. $450 is too cheap.

Also I don't think there is such a thing as "Wet floating ball bearings" LoL. It either has floating bush bearings or ball bearings.

Dodgy.

I would say your best bet is the snort performance guy. He had a new turbo/manifold/oil lines package for $3000. But you still need piping, exhaust, intercooler, and $2000 worth of fuel and aftermarked ECU upgrades.

Even seccond hand your not going to get a turbo setup for less than $5000 and prob more according to the people on here. Read the info on this forum and learn from other peoples mistakes/ sucesses.

yeah, that turbo looks dodge

With turbos, keep to your brand names (turbonetics, garret ect...)
otherwise you will pay the price of buying a propper, better turbo 200k's down the track :P

generaly a To4 size turbo would suit for a good amount of power but something more like a T66 or something would suit better for a smoother progressive power. Better suited for more power but will cost a bit more.


Most setups will cost you $5+ for a simple, 350-400fwhp setup, but have a search tho the forums about it coz there are heaps of "how to's".

Your best bet is to tell us how much money you wanna spend and how much power you want
